Prayer to Conquer the Crippling Power of Fear Over our Lives.

Divine Creator,In humble reverence, we gather before you, seeking solace and strength in the face of the paralyzing grip of fear that consumes our lives. We acknowledge that fear has the power to distort our perceptions, cloud our judgment, and hinder our progress. Today, we come to you with open hearts, beseeching your divine intervention to conquer the crippling power of fear that holds us captive.

Grant us, O Mighty Source of Love, the wisdom to recognize the illusions woven by fear and the courage to rise above them. Illuminate our paths with the light of understanding, so we may discern the difference between genuine danger and imagined threats. Help us see that fear often arises from our own insecurities, limiting beliefs, and past traumas, and enable us to release these burdens that hinder our growth.

Fill our souls with unwavering faith, for we know that in your presence, fear cannot persist. Nurture within us a deep trust in your divine plan, knowing that you hold us in the palm of your hand. Strengthen our belief in our own inherent worth and potential, reminding us that we are capable of overcoming any adversity with your grace.

Grant us the serenity to accept the things we cannot change, the courage to change the things we can, and the wisdom to know the difference. Teach us to surrender our fears into your compassionate embrace, finding solace in the knowledge that you are always with us, guiding and protecting us.

May your boundless love permeate our hearts, casting out the shadows of fear and replacing them with the radiant light of hope and resilience. Empower us to walk boldly on our chosen paths, undeterred by fear’s attempts to hinder our progress. Awaken within us the unshakable conviction that we are deserving of joy, peace, and success, dispelling the doubts and self-limiting beliefs that fear imposes.

As we confront the challenges that lie ahead, may we draw strength from the wellspring of courage deep within us, knowing that your spirit abides within our very beings. Grant us the grace to face our fears head-on, transforming them into opportunities for growth and personal transformation.

Today, we surrender our fears to you, dear Creator, and place our trust in your infinite power and love. Grant us the fortitude to conquer the crippling power of fear and embrace the fullness of life that you have ordained for us. With your divine guidance, we are certain that fear will no longer wield its dominion over our lives, and we will emerge triumphant, walking in the light of your love. In your holy name, we pray, Amen.

10 bible verses on Fear

Here are ten Bible verses on fear along with brief explanations:

  1. Psalm 23:4 (NIV): “Even though I walk through the darkest valley, I will fear no evil, for you are with me; your rod and your staff, they comfort me.” Explanation: This verse reminds us that even in the midst of challenging times, we can find comfort and strength in God’s presence. His guidance and protection alleviate our fears.
  2. Isaiah 41:10 (NIV): “So do not fear, for I am with you; do not be dismayed, for I am your God. I will strengthen you and help you; I will uphold you with my righteous right hand.” Explanation: God reassures us that His presence gives us courage and support. He promises to strengthen and uphold us, eradicating our fears and worries.
  3. Joshua 1:9 (NIV): “Have I not commanded you? Be strong and courageous. Do not be afraid; do not be discouraged, for the Lord your God will be with you wherever you go.” Explanation: God’s command to be strong and courageous reminds us that fear is not in alignment with His plan for our lives. He promises His presence and guidance as we step forward in faith.
  4. 2 Timothy 1:7 (NIV): “For the Spirit God gave us does not make us timid, but gives us power, love, and self-discipline.” Explanation: God’s Spirit dwelling within us empowers us to overcome fear. It equips us with power, love, and self-discipline, enabling us to face fear with confidence.
  5. Philippians 4:6-7 (NIV): “Do not be anxious about anything, but in every situation, by prayer and petition, with thanksgiving, present your requests to God. And the peace of God, which transcends all understanding, will guard your hearts and your minds in Christ Jesus.” Explanation: Instead of allowing fear and anxiety to consume us, we are encouraged to bring our concerns to God in prayer. In doing so, His peace, surpassing all understanding, will guard our hearts and minds.
  6. Psalm 34:4 (NIV): “I sought the Lord, and he answered me; he delivered me from all my fears.” Explanation: This verse highlights the power of seeking the Lord. When we turn to Him, He responds and delivers us from all our fears, providing us with freedom and peace.
  7. 1 John 4:18 (NIV): “There is no fear in love. But perfect love drives out fear because fear has to do with punishment. The one who fears is not made perfect in love.” Explanation: God’s perfect love dispels fear. When we fully grasp and embrace His love, fear loses its grip on us. The more we grow in love, the less room fear has in our hearts.
  8. Matthew 6:34 (NIV): “Therefore do not worry about tomorrow, for tomorrow will worry about itself. Each day has enough trouble of its own.” Explanation: Jesus encourages us not to worry about the future, as it can trigger fear and anxiety. Instead, He reminds us to focus on each day, trusting God’s provision and guidance in the present moment.
  9. Psalm 56:3 (NIV): “When I am afraid, I put my trust in you.” Explanation: This verse acknowledges that fear may arise in our lives, but it encourages us to place our trust in God. Trusting Him allows us to find solace and overcome our fears.
  10. Isaiah 41:13 (NIV): “For Iam the LORD your God who takes hold of your right hand and says to you, Do not fear; I will help you.” Explanation: God reassures us of His unwavering support and assistance. He takes hold of our hand, guiding us and urging us not to fear, for He is our Helper and Provider.

Tips On Over comingĀ  fear as christians

Here are ten tips on how to stop being afraid as Christians:

  1. Seek God’s Presence: Spend time in prayer, worship, and meditation, seeking a deeper connection with God. His presence brings comfort, peace, and courage.
  2. Immerse Yourself in God’s Word: Regularly read and study the Bible to discover God’s promises, assurances, and stories of faith. The truth of His Word dispels fear and strengthens faith.
  3. Trust in God’s Sovereignty: Remind yourself that God is in control of all things. Surrender your fears to Him, knowing that His plans are perfect, and He works all things for good.
  4. Build a Supportive Christian Community: Surround yourself with fellow believers who can encourage, uplift, and pray with you. Together, you can navigate through fears and offer support to one another.
  5. Replace Negative Thoughts with Truth: Challenge fearful thoughts with the truth of God’s Word. Meditate on His promises and affirmations, replacing fear with faith-filled declarations.
  6. Practice Gratitude: Cultivate a heart of gratitude by focusing on God’s blessings and faithfulness. Gratitude shifts our perspective from fear to trust, reminding us of God’s goodness.
  7. Embrace God’s Love: Reflect on the depth of God’s love for you. Allow His perfect love to cast out fear, knowing that His love protects, provides, and guides you.
  8. Recall Past Victories: Remember times when God has brought you through challenging situations. Reflecting on His faithfulness in the past bolsters your faith and diminishes fear.
  9. Step Out in Faith: Take courageous steps in obedience to God’s leading, even when fear tries to hold you back. Trust that God will equip and empower you for every task.
  10. Seek Wisdom and Guidance: Seek counsel from mature Christians, pastors, or spiritual mentors when facing specific fears or uncertainties. Their wisdom and guidance can provide valuable insights and perspective.

Remember, overcoming fear is a journey that requires consistent effort, reliance on God’s strength, and a commitment to growing in faith. With God’s help, you can experience freedom from fear and walk in the confidence of His love and power.
